是指在仿真过程中,波形查看器(waveform viewer)中显示的信号可能会误导开发人员,导致对设计的理解出现偏差或错误。
在systemverilog中,开发人员可以使用波形查看器来观察和分析设计中的信号波形。波形查看器可以显示信号的时序变化,帮助开发人员调试和验证设计的正确性。
然而,波形查看器中的信号波形可能会存在危险。这些危险可能包括:
- 信号显示不准确:波形查看器可能无法准确地显示信号的时序变化,导致开发人员对信号的行为产生误解。
- 信号显示延迟:波形查看器可能会存在信号显示的延迟,导致开发人员无法准确地观察到信号的实际变化。
- 信号显示冲突:波形查看器可能会将多个信号的波形叠加在一起显示,导致开发人员无法清晰地分辨各个信号的变化。
为了避免波形查看器中的危险,开发人员可以采取以下措施:
- 仔细检查信号定义:确保在设计中正确定义信号,并在仿真过程中正确地连接信号。
- 使用断言(assertion)进行验证:通过在设计中添加断言,可以在仿真过程中对信号进行验证,确保其行为符合预期。
- 使用其他调试工具:除了波形查看器,还可以使用其他调试工具来验证设计的正确性,例如时序分析工具、逻辑分析仪等。
- 与团队成员进行交流:及时与团队成员进行交流,共享对设计的理解和观察,以减少对波形查看器的依赖。
腾讯云相关产品和产品介绍链接地址:
腾讯云提供了一系列云计算相关的产品和服务,包括计算、存储、数据库、人工智能等。以下是一些与systemverilog开发相关的腾讯云产品:
- 云服务器(CVM):提供弹性计算能力,可用于进行systemverilog仿真和开发。产品介绍链接:https://cloud.tencent.com/product/cvm
- 云数据库MySQL版(CDB):提供高性能、可扩展的MySQL数据库服务,可用于存储systemverilog设计中的数据。产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
请注意,以上仅为示例,腾讯云还提供其他与云计算相关的产品和服务,具体可根据实际需求进行选择和使用。